Recovered patients
In the past twenty-four hours, 87 patients with laboratory and clinico-epidemiologically confirmed COVID-19 diagnosis recovered and were discharged from care across the republic, including: in Bishkek city – 46 patients, Osh city – 1, Chuy province – 30, Osh province – 0, Talas province – 0, Naryn province – 0, Issyk-Kul province – 5, Jalal-Abad province – 2, Batken province – 3.
Total number of recoveries during the entire period: 85 164 patients.

New cases
As of April 4th, 2021, a total of 172 new cases of laboratory and clinico-epidemiologically confirmed COVID-19 were registered across the republic in the past twenty-four hours. These include: Bishkek city – 124, Osh city – 2, Chuy province – 33, Osh province – 1, Talas province – 1, Naryn province – 0, Issyk-Kul province – 10, Jalal-Abad province – 1, Batken province – 0.
Overall, 89 014 cases were registered during the entire period, including 46 379 laboratory-confirmed cases and 42 635 cases confirmed based on clinical and epidemiological data.

2 497 PCR tests were carried out in the past twenty-four hours.
Receiving treatment
Currently, a total of 625 patients throughout the republic are receiving inpatient care, while 768 people are in outpatient care.
The number of cases in inpatient facilities comprises: in Bishkek city – 324, Osh city – 19, Chuy province – 195, Osh province – 4, Talas province – 0, Naryn province – 10, Issyk-Kul province – 47, Jalal-Abad province – 23, Batken province – 3. Out of the 625 patients receiving inpatient care, the condition of 477 people (76.3%) is categorized as moderately severe, 119 (19%) are in severe condition and 29 (4.6%) – in critical condition.
The number of patients with laboratory and clinico-epidemiologically confirmed COVID-19 who are receiving outpatient (at home) treatment comprises: in Bishkek city – 570, Osh city – 4, Chuy province – 144, Osh province – 11, Talas province – 1, Naryn province – 8, Issyk-Kul province – 22, Jalal-Abad province – 1, Batken province – 7.
Fatalities
Four (4) deaths due to COVID-19 were registered in the past twenty-four hours, including 3 cases due to laboratory-confirmed COVID-19 (Bishkek – 2, Chuy – 1) and 1 case due to COVID-19 confirmed on the basis of clinical and epidemiological data (Bishkek). The overall death toll due to COVID-19 in the republic comprises 1506 cases, including 475 laboratory-confirmed cases and 1031 cases confirmed based on clinical and epidemiological data.
Medical workers
Seven (7) new COVID-19 cases were registered among medical workers in the past twenty-four hours, including 1 case in the red zone – all in Bishkek. The total number of medical workers diagnosed with COVID-19 is 4266. In the past twenty-four hours, 2 medical workers were discharged from inpatient care, and 1 medical worker was released from self-isolation at home. In total, 4206 medical workers have recovered in the republic.
